Samsung follows other electronics giants into the auto industry
Samsung has announced it will begin manufacturing electronics parts for the automotive industry, with a specific focus on autonomous vehicles.
The South Korean electronics giant is only the latest tech firm to make a somewhat belated push into the carmaker industry, as vehicle computer systems and sensors become more sophisticated.
In October, General Motors announced a strategic partnership with South Korea's LG Electronics. LG will supply a majority of the key components for GM's upcoming electric vehicle (EV), the Chevrolet Bolt. LG has also been building computer modules for GM's OnStar telecommunications system for years.
